In today's market, small-sized diesel engines used for passenger cars, RVs and com. use vehicles are being pushed to new limits in fuel consumption, output and durability.As a result of these demands, engine bearings are used under increasingly severe loads and temperaturesA problem with the conventional aluminum alloy bearings which are used in these conditions is their low fatigue resistance.For this reason, a new aluminum alloy bearing, which contains no lead and reaches new levels in fatigue and corrosion resistance, was developed by improving the tensile strength of the alloy to 185 MPa.The performance of this new bearing alloy is described.
